About Sheng‐Kai Sun
Sheng‐Kai Sun is a scholar working on Environmental Chemistry, Plant Science, Molecular Biology, Nutrition and Dietetics and Materials Chemistry, having authored 10 papers that have together received 502 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Arsenic contamination and mitigation (8 papers), Silicon Effects in Agriculture (3 papers), Nitrogen and Sulfur Effects on Brassica (3 papers), Plant Micronutrient Interactions and Effects (2 papers), Aluminum toxicity and tolerance in plants and animals (2 papers),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(2 papers), Selenium in Biological Systems (2 papers) and Metalloenzymes and iron-sulfur proteins (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Environmental Chemistry (220 citations), Pollution (168 citations), Plant Science (270 citations), Geochemistry and Petrology (32 citations) and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is (69 citations). Sheng‐Kai Sun has collaborated with scholars based in China, Germany and Japan. Frequent co-authors include Fang‐Jie Zhao, Zhong Tang, Yi Chen, Tony Miller, Jian Feng, Jing Che, Noriyuki Konishi, Xin‐Yuan Huang, Zhu Tang and Markus Wirtz.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Experimental Botany, Nature Communications, New Phytologist, Environmental Science Nano and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
